Luke Osborne has extensive experience in project management and IT support, beginning with roles as an IT Site Engineer at Kelway and IT Support Engineer at LVMH. A progression to Mace included positions as Assistant Project Manager and Project Manager from December 2015 to January 2021. Luke then advanced to Senior Project Manager at Turner & Townsend from May 2022 to March 2024 and is currently in the same role at Linesight. Educationally, Luke obtained a Higher National Certificate in Construction Management from London South Bank University (2016-2018) and completed GCSEs at Moulsham High School (2007-2011).
This person is not in any teams
This person is not in any offices